Market Value
The price at which an asset would trade in a competitive auction setting.
Common Stock
A type of equity security that represents ownership in a corporation, entitling holders to vote on corporate matters and receive dividends.
Retained Earnings
The portion of a business's profits not distributed to shareholders but reinvested in the business or held for future use.
Surplus Cash
Excess funds that a company retains over its necessary working capital and capital expenditure requirements, often available for investment or distribution.
